Output 18753364085b252871c9dbefb7ecbef7d342b855af1f0f523a05d0ce34c866b5:8

value
1205792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34339390b407befb2f7c81eec099de8743d65d0b OP_EQUAL
address
36T2r7SerEPjDZgbqr54C3KzPD223CYx58
transaction
18753364085b252871c9dbefb7ecbef7d342b855af1f0f523a05d0ce34c866b5
spent
true